Output 74e57bcb57f3b63b9832d17f5c1927eb94901774cebf3ffabb7eb58e4ae2329e:0

value
2727555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ff96d3545027fc50233da96196427b7514b3a38 OP_EQUAL
address
3EpHMSRLBxP74vH5cufg2iXiQhcVFGyu7S
transaction
74e57bcb57f3b63b9832d17f5c1927eb94901774cebf3ffabb7eb58e4ae2329e
spent
true